O que é função no WordPress?

O que é função no WordPress?

No universo do WordPress, uma função é um conjunto de instruções que define o comportamento e as capacidades de um determinado elemento do site. As funções são essenciais para o funcionamento do WordPress, pois permitem que os desenvolvedores personalizem e estendam as funcionalidades do sistema de gerenciamento de conteúdo.

Tipos de funções no WordPress

No WordPress, existem diferentes tipos de funções que podem ser utilizadas para diferentes finalidades. Vamos explorar alguns dos principais tipos de funções:

Funções do tema

As funções do tema são aquelas que estão relacionadas à aparência e ao design do site. Elas permitem que os desenvolvedores personalizem o layout, as cores, as fontes e outros aspectos visuais do site. Além disso, as funções do tema também podem ser utilizadas para adicionar funcionalidades específicas ao tema, como a criação de áreas de widget ou a implementação de um menu personalizado.

Funções do plugin

As funções do plugin são aquelas que estão relacionadas à adição de novas funcionalidades ao site. Os plugins são pequenos programas que podem ser instalados no WordPress para adicionar recursos extras ao sistema. As funções do plugin permitem que os desenvolvedores personalizem e estendam as funcionalidades do WordPress de acordo com as necessidades do site.

Funções do usuário

As funções do usuário são aquelas que estão relacionadas à atribuição de permissões e privilégios aos usuários do site. No WordPress, existem diferentes níveis de acesso que podem ser atribuídos aos usuários, como administrador, editor, autor, colaborador e assinante. As funções do usuário permitem que os administradores do site controlem o que cada usuário pode fazer e visualizar no WordPress.

Funções de ação

As funções de ação são aquelas que são executadas em momentos específicos durante a execução do WordPress. Elas permitem que os desenvolvedores adicionem ou modifiquem o comportamento do sistema em determinados eventos, como a criação de um novo post, a atualização de um post existente ou o carregamento de uma página específica. As funções de ação são muito úteis para personalizar o funcionamento do WordPress de acordo com as necessidades do site.

Funções de filtro

As funções de filtro são aquelas que permitem que os desenvolvedores modifiquem ou adicionem conteúdo antes que ele seja exibido no site. Elas são utilizadas para alterar a saída de determinados elementos do WordPress, como o título de um post, o conteúdo de um widget ou a descrição de uma categoria. As funções de filtro são muito úteis para personalizar a aparência e o conteúdo do site de acordo com as necessidades do projeto.

Como utilizar as funções no WordPress?

Para utilizar as funções no WordPress, é necessário ter conhecimentos de programação em PHP, a linguagem de programação utilizada pelo WordPress. As funções podem ser adicionadas ao arquivo functions.php do tema ativo ou podem ser criadas em um plugin personalizado.

Para adicionar uma função ao arquivo functions.php do tema ativo, basta abrir o arquivo em um editor de texto e adicionar o código da função no final do arquivo. É importante lembrar de adicionar o código dentro das tags para que ele seja interpretado corretamente pelo PHP.

Para criar um plugin personalizado, é necessário criar um novo diretório na pasta wp-content/plugins do WordPress e criar um arquivo PHP com o código da função. O arquivo do plugin deve ter um cabeçalho especial que define as informações básicas do plugin, como o nome, a descrição e a versão.

Depois de adicionar a função ao arquivo functions.php do tema ou ao arquivo do plugin personalizado, é possível utilizá-la em qualquer parte do site. Para chamar a função, basta utilizar o nome da função seguido de parênteses, como por exemplo: minha_funcao().

Conclusão

As funções no WordPress são essenciais para personalizar e estender as funcionalidades do sistema de gerenciamento de conteúdo. Com as funções, é possível modificar o design, adicionar novas funcionalidades, controlar as permissões dos usuários e personalizar o comportamento do WordPress de acordo com as necessidades do site. Para utilizar as funções, é necessário ter conhecimentos de programação em PHP e saber como adicionar as funções ao arquivo functions.php do tema ou criar um plugin personalizado. Com as funções, é possível criar sites poderosos e otimizados para SEO, que rankeiam bem no Google.

Mais posts do mesmo assunto